What Affects the Duration of Invisalign in Peoria?
Once your treatment plan is created, your aligners are custom-made for you. The average length of Invisalign in Peoria ranges from 6 to 18 months. However, the total time can vary depending on several factors:
-
Severity of Alignment Issues: Minor spacing or crowding might only take a few months to correct, while more complex issues require longer treatment.
-
Patient Compliance: Invisalign aligners should be worn 20 to 22 hours per day. Removing them too often can delay your results.
-
Age of the Patient: Younger patients sometimes see quicker results due to their more responsive dental structures.
-
Attachment Usage: Small tooth-colored bumps called attachments may be added to help aligners grip teeth better, increasing their effectiveness and potentially shortening the timeline.
You’ll receive a new set of aligners every 1 to 2 weeks. Each set gradually moves your teeth closer to the desired position. Unlike braces, there are no wires or brackets to adjust, but regular check-ins with your orthodontist are essential to ensure everything is progressing smoothly.
Working with an Orthodontist Near You
Throughout your Invisalign treatment, it’s important to have an orthodontist near you who can provide ongoing support and guidance. Your orthodontist will schedule check-ups every 6 to 8 weeks to monitor your progress and make adjustments to your treatment plan if needed.
These appointments are usually brief and much less invasive than traditional orthodontic visits. Your orthodontist will also offer tips to help you stay on track—such as using chewies (small soft cylinders that help seat aligners more securely), cleaning recommendations, and reminders about consistent wear.
Invisalign is popular not only because of its appearance but also because it allows more flexibility in daily life. You can remove your aligners when eating, drinking (except water), and brushing, which makes maintaining oral hygiene easier than with traditional braces.
Life After Invisalign
Once your Invisalign treatment is complete and your teeth are in their final positions, you’ll need to wear a retainer to maintain your results. Most orthodontists recommend wearing a retainer full-time for the first few months and then only at night. This phase is crucial because teeth can shift back if retainers aren’t worn as directed.
During your final Invisalign visit, your orthodontist will provide your custom retainers and instructions for use. This ensures your beautifully aligned smile stays intact for years to come.
